Output 3ec4dd540d7bd1af176fadeb041b6bf205ae949b72f1b51a342f48166a5edb7d:0

value
31871239
script pubkey
OP_0 OP_PUSHBYTES_20 abf835145d8a75e5ec118d129c3c9261d76f318e
address
bc1q40ur29za3f67tmq335ffc0yjv8tk7vvwnhqcr7
transaction
3ec4dd540d7bd1af176fadeb041b6bf205ae949b72f1b51a342f48166a5edb7d
spent
true